fix(test): make test_google_endpoint_routing resilient to module reloads (#24499)
Same root cause as test_end_user_jwt_auth: test_cors_config reloads proxy_server module, so initialize() sets llm_router on the old module while the test's patch target resolves to the new one where it's None. Fix by syncing llm_router from the original module to the live sys.modules entry after initialize(). Co-authored-by: Claude Opus 4.6 <noreply@anthropic.com>
